Completing My Set of Brigham Bent Bulldogs
I've collected a few Brigham Shape 26 Bent Bulldog pipes over the years. The shape is one of my favourites, and was produced at every level in the Brigham range except the entry-grade 100 series. I had examples of the shape in 3-, 4-, and 5-Dot versions, so when I had the opportunity to acquire… Continue reading Completing My Set of Brigham Bent Bulldogs
